We have separated
Suspense from Thrillers,
Mysteries from Crime Fiction,
Chick Lit from Romance,

but I am not brave enough to attempt to split fantasy from science fiction. 
After all, Clark's Law, pt.3 applies here  (Any sufficiently advanced 
technology is indistinguishable from magic).

Plus, we display our new fiction books in  14 genre collections. We keep 
about one year's worth of new titles displayed there. If SF and fantasy 
were split, neither collection would have enough new titles to attain 
critical mass. So our rule is if one year's worth of new books (minus what 
will be checked out) does not add up to a good display collection, then 
there is no sense in having a separate collection.
